我已经用谷歌搜索了它,然后我读到“清理并构建”它,但是不知何故,当我双击 dist 文件夹中的 jar 文件时它不起作用,当我尝试从 NetBeans 运行它时不再工作了,我必须做一个新项目。我错过了什么让它工作吗?我只需要jar文件吗?
问问题
2745 次
1 回答
0
如果您要获取可执行的 jar 文件,请执行“清理和构建”;但在此之前,请确保您的输出窗口可见。如果不是,请按 Ctrl+4。
在运行“清理和构建”过程时,请仔细观察输出窗口是否有任何错误。如果有,请在此处发布。
现在查看 dist 文件夹中的 jar。
通常,在 dist 文件夹中有一个 lib 文件夹,其中包含运行应用程序所需的其他库,而在我的 Netbeans 7.3 中,它不需要任何额外的命令行参数即可将 lib 文件夹添加到类路径中。相反,他们有一个JavaFX-Class-Path
MANIFEST.MF 中的参数。如果您使用的是旧版本的 Netbeans 并且在 MANIFEST.MF 中没有这些参数,您可以通过使用 WinRAR 或任何其他存档管理器编辑 jar 文件来手动添加它,然后添加JavaFX-Class-Path:
lib 文件夹中每个 jar 文件的名称. 例如:JavaFX-Class-Path: lib/mylib1.jar lib/mylib2.jar lib/anotherlib.jar
。
希望这有帮助。如果您还有其他疑问,请发表评论..谢谢。
于 2013-06-18T18:31:20.090 回答